Chicago Bears Injury Report: Zach Miller, Alshon Jeffery and Eddie Royal all questionable

Here’s the full injury report for the Chicago Bears and the Jacksonville Jaguars. The two teams will meet this Sunday at Soldier Field.

Injuries have been an issue for the 2016 Chicago Bears. It’s not the only reason the team is 1-4, but it’s not helping things either.

This week the Bears will again have some key players missing time, with cornerback Deiondre' Hall already ruled out. Listed as doubtful, but not expected to play are QB Jay Cutler, RB Jeremy Langford and NT Eddie Goldman.

The Bears have a lengthy list of questionables;

WR - Alshon Jeffery
WR - Eddie Royal
TE - Zach Miller
OLB - Leonard Floyd
LG - Josh Sitton
RT - Bobby Massie
OLB - Willie Young
CB - Tracy Porter
CB - Bryce Callahan
OLB - Sam Acho
RB - Ka’Deem Carey

Among the questionable Bears, only Royal and Floyd missed Friday’s practice. Royal also missed all of last week’s practice, but he did play against the Colts. Floyd, who was limited earlier this week with his calf injury, could be a game time decision.

The big news out of Halas Hall today was the return of outside linebacker Pernell McPhee to practice. He’s not eligible to play to Sunday, but the coaches were pleased to get him on the field.

The other PUP listed player, wide out Marquess Wilson, was not brought back today and he was spotted in a walking boot. Head coach John Fox said that there wasn’t a set back with Wilson’s injury.

For the Jacksonville Jaguars, they have three players listed as questionable.

RB - Corey Grant
WR - Rashad Greene
TE - Neal Sterling

Also the Jags will be without starting left guard Luke Joeckel who recently went on their injured list. In his place should be ex Bear Patrick Omameh.
